Output ae4e23045b358ec03f6091e4e04dfb860eb52106a7a63ca99b4129fd4e91baf9:0

value
59469460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d94139655ed3df651742b720dd46767b59ab87 OP_EQUAL
address
31mWBfrJeQBxahSaVbgKTBFYG4XUDqeeBN
transaction
ae4e23045b358ec03f6091e4e04dfb860eb52106a7a63ca99b4129fd4e91baf9
confirmations
384119
spent
true